LeCoultre and Vacheron Constantin Wristwatch 1950s with Diamond Mystery 'Galaxy' Dial in 14ct Gold brand_Trench The watch is circa 1970sThis Watch This highly collectable watch is the result of the only collaboration that ever took place between Vacheron and LeCoultre, despite the long history between the two companies. The watch is triple signed; on the case it is signed by both companies with "Vacheron & Constantin LeCoultre Watches Inc.", the movement is signed "Le Coultre Co." and the dial, "LeCoultre." The black, enamel dial is set with thirty seven genuine diamonds, all in white
